Pros

Most, if not all, employees work remotely. This drives a flexible schedule culture. Benefits and pay are on par with the industrty.

Cons

There is a significant disconnect between leaders and employees—the company, headquartered in London, but owned by an Austin Private Equity firm, is largely detached from the reality of its US and Indian employees' lives. While its metric-driven approach is transparent, the arguments for achieving those metrics are just wrong. The Company is outsourcing the management of its US Banking efforts to Canada and Europe. There needs to be more knowledge about American banking and management practices within leadership.
